More about the book

The book delves into the complex relationship between Christianity and African Traditional Religion, focusing on Zimbabwean Pentecostals, particularly the Zimbabwe Assemblies of God, Africa (ZAOGA). It highlights how these Pentecostals integrate elements of Shona traditional beliefs into their Christian practices, despite their public opposition to traditional religion. The study argues that traditional beliefs continue to influence the lives of Zimbabwean Pentecostals, revealing a nuanced interplay between faith and cultural heritage.
